The Android port does not run on an official Valve engine. Instead, it utilizes the , an open-source recreation of the GoldSrc engine that powered original games like Half-Life and Counter-Strike 1.6. By combining the Xash3D emulator with the original PC game data files, you can achieve a flawless, native-feeling gameplay experience on modern mobile screens. Prerequisites and System Requirements
